What is the Razorpay MCP Server?
The Razorpay MCP Server is a middleware service based on the Model Context Protocol (MCP). It allows AI assistants (such as Cursor, Claude, Copilot, etc.) to securely interact with your Razorpay payment gateway. Through standardized interfaces, AI can directly query payment records, order information, settlement data, etc., without complex API integration.How to use the Razorpay MCP Server?
Simply install and configure your Razorpay API key, and the AI assistant can obtain permission to query payment data. It supports multiple usage methods: direct integration with code editors, connection via web applications, or deployment using Docker containers.Use cases
Suitable for scenarios where AI assistants are needed to analyze payment data, generate financial reports, and troubleshoot transaction issues. For example, query recent payment trends through natural language, find orders of specific customers, or check account balances, etc.Main features
Comprehensive data accessSupports querying all major Razorpay resources such as payments, orders, settlements, refunds, disputes, invoices, contacts, transactions, Virtual Payment Addresses (VPA), and customers.
Multi - platform supportProvides three running modes: stdio (command line), SSE (web page), and Docker, suitable for different usage scenarios.
Intelligent paginationAll list queries support pagination parameters (count, skip) and time range filtering (from, to), facilitating the handling of large data sets.
Secure authenticationAuthenticates using the official Razorpay API key to ensure secure data transmission.
Advantages and limitations
Advantages
Allow AI assistants to access Razorpay data without development
The standardized MCP protocol is compatible with multiple AI tools
Lightweight deployment, supporting multiple operating environments
Real - time data access with fast response
Limitations
Currently only supports data query functions, not write operations such as creating payments
Requires exposing the Razorpay API key, which needs to be properly safeguarded
Pagination queries return a maximum of 100 records
